Are Bronco Sports reliable in 2021?


The Ford Bronco Sport, introduced as part of Ford's revival of the Bronco lineup, has quickly gained popularity among SUV enthusiasts. But when it comes to reliability, how does the 2021 Bronco Sport measure up? As an experienced auto service provider, I’ll break down the key aspects of the Bronco Sport’s reliability to help you make an informed decision.


What Makes a Vehicle Reliable?


Reliability in a vehicle is determined by several factors, including build quality, performance consistency, maintenance requirements, and customer satisfaction. For the 2021 Bronco Sport, these factors are influenced by its design, engineering, and the feedback from early adopters.


Strengths of the 2021 Bronco Sport


The 2021 Bronco Sport has several features that contribute to its reliability:



  • Durable Build: Built on Ford's C2 platform, the Bronco Sport shares its underpinnings with the Ford Escape, which has a proven track record for reliability.

  • Off-Road Capability: Designed for adventure, the Bronco Sport includes features like standard 4x4, G.O.A.T. (Goes Over Any Terrain) modes, and a robust suspension system, making it a dependable choice for rugged terrains.

  • Safety Features: Equipped with Ford Co-Pilot360, the Bronco Sport offers advanced safety technologies such as automatic emergency braking, blind-spot monitoring, and lane-keeping assist, which enhance driver confidence and reduce the likelihood of accidents.


Potential Concerns


While the Bronco Sport has many strengths, there are a few areas where reliability concerns have been noted:



  • Transmission Issues: Some early owners have reported minor transmission quirks, such as hesitation during gear shifts. These issues are not widespread but are worth monitoring.

  • Turbocharged Engine Maintenance: The Bronco Sport’s turbocharged engines deliver excellent performance but may require more diligent maintenance to ensure long-term reliability.

  • First-Year Model Challenges: As with many first-year models, the 2021 Bronco Sport may experience teething issues as Ford works out initial production kinks.


Maintenance Tips for Longevity


To maximize the reliability of your 2021 Bronco Sport, consider the following maintenance tips:



  • Follow the manufacturer’s recommended maintenance schedule for oil changes, tire rotations, and inspections.

  • Keep an eye on the transmission performance and report any irregularities to your trusted mechanic.

  • Use high-quality fuel and oil to maintain the health of the turbocharged engine.

  • Inspect and clean off-road components, such as the undercarriage, after adventures to prevent wear and tear.

What is the reliability score of the 2021 Ford Bronco Sport?


The 2021 Ford Bronco Sport has a predicted reliability score of 82 out of 100. A J.D. Power predicted reliability score of 91-100 is considered the Best, 81-90 is Great, 70-80 is Average and 0-69 is Fair and considered below average.



What is the engine problem with the 2021 Ford Bronco?


The recall affects 2021 to 2022 models with those engines, including the Ford F-150, Bronco, Explorer, and Edge; the Lincoln Aviator and Nautilus are affected too. Ford says the issue involves faulty engine intake valves that may fracture and fall into the combustion chamber, causing catastrophic failure.

Are there any recalls on 2021 Bronco Sport?


Summary: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2021-2022 Bronco Sport and Escape vehicles. The rear brake linings may have been manufactured incorrectly, which can affect braking performance.
